Video Game Emulators - Should You Use Them?

Are you familiar with video game emulators (Veo Game Emulators)? Are you curious about video game emulators and their workings? A video game emulator is a type of computer program invented to use one computer system to help it act like a different system. For the sake of video games, this can be beneficial because it allows a player with a modern computer to play video games from older systems or platforms without going out to purchase that original system or machine. In fact, you can even use game emulators to play games for platforms that are now obsolete. Others use them simply because they prefer to play games on their PC over the console.


Console emulators can work by recreating the other system and making it compatible with your computer. The most popular use for these is to revisit games from past consoles without having the console system anymore. You might be able find your favorite games on emulators if you have played games on your Atari or Nintendo, original Playstation, Sega, and other consoles.


Sometimes, video game emulators can be used to "modify" older games or to translate them into other languages. People have even created new games for the older game consoles to be played with emulators.


Although it may sound appealing to play your old console games on your home computer, there are many legal issues surrounding video game emulators. So is it legal?


Copyright is a key issue in the legality of video game emulators. If the original copyright of the game belongs to the game developer, does anyone else have the right to recreate that game for a different platform? Video games are subject to copyright. It can be illegal to obtain the serial rights for the game. It can also be a violation to use them when you have not purchased the game. So video game emulators are legal but downloading pirated video games or ROM's is not.


Many websites that offer videogame emulators have a disclaimer warning you to not download any videogames that you don't already own the paid version. This becomes a legal problem if the warning is ignored and people download games that they don't own.
